What Are Fireproof Cast Bricks?
Fireproof cast bricks, commonly referred to as refractory bricks, are engineered to withstand high temperatures without losing their integrity or structural stability. Unlike traditional bricks, which may crack or crumble when exposed to extreme heat, fireproof cast bricks are made from materials such as alumina, silica, and other mineral compounds that offer superior thermal resistance. They are primarily used in furnaces, kilns, fireplaces, and other applications where high heat is a constant factor.
The Importance of Quality Manufacturing
The manufacturing process of fireproof cast bricks is intricate and requires adherence to stringent quality control measures. Reputable manufacturers engage in sourcing high-quality raw materials, employing advanced technologies, and adhering to international standards. The production process typically involves shaping the raw materials into blocks, followed by firing them in specialized kilns at high temperatures to enhance their durability and thermal properties.
Quality manufacturers understand that even the minutest deviation in the manufacturing process can lead to significant failures in their products when subjected to heat. As such, they invest in research and development to innovate better materials and methods that will improve the performance of fireproof cast bricks.
